The NFF 🇳🇬 on Twitter - FT Poland 0-1 Nigeria #SoarSuperEagles #POLNGA. The @NGSuperEagles record a morale-boosting victory over Poland at the Municipal Stadium in Wroclaw. Their journey to Russia continues on Tuesday ( 27th March 2018) as they have a date with #Serbia in London.
